Originally launched in 2016 as a Flash-based web game, Moto X3M was later adapted to by developer Madpuffers . This shift was critical for the game's longevity, as Flash was officially discontinued by Adobe in late 2020. On GitHub, you can find numerous repositories—such as silvereengames/moto-x3m and broplsss/Moto-X3M-Winter —that host the HTML5 source files for the original game and its sequels like Moto X3M Winter and Moto X3M Spooky Land .
